What is Keystroke Logging?


Keystroke Monitoring is a process by which a computer system administrator views or records both the keystrokes entered by a computer user and the computer's response. Examples of keystroke monitoring would include viewing characters as they are typed by users, reading users' email, and viewing other recorded information typed by users. Some forms of everyday system maintenance record user keystrokes; this could incorporate keystroke monitoring if the keystrokes are saved together with the user identification so that an administrator can determine the keystrokes entered by
specific users.
